What companies run services between Stuttgart, Germany and Pescara, Italy?

You can take a train from Hauptbahnhof to Pescara Centrale via Singen, Zürich HB, Milano Centrale, and Reggio Emilia Av in around 13h 20m. Alternatively, Busitalia Simet S.p.A. operates a bus from Fellbach to Pescara once a week. Tickets cost €80–95 and the journey takes 12h 34m.
